Re: Week 6: OSU @ Nebraska
Philly Brown is in.
Nathan Williams is out.
Solomon Thomas will travel but is doubtful to play due to recovering from off season broken leg.
Posey and Boom are suspended, along with Marcus Hall.
Mike Adams is back.
